Hello, I designed a way to feed email from RAID-controllers (3ware) to Nagios but I am not sure how save the proposed solution is. First I added an alias to /etc/aliases: nagios: "|/usr/local/nagios/libexec/eventhandlers/handle-RAID-mail"
Second I wrote the script nagios/libexec/eventhandlers/handle-RAID-mail Finally I had the problem, that postfixs "local", who delivers the email to handle-RAID-mail is chown nobody:nogroup which is far from being able to write into nagios/var/rw/nagcmd. So I did: $ sudo postconf -e default_privs=nagios Now "local" runs as user nagios and the checks are fed into Nagios BUT: Is there a more secure solution around w/o tampering the permissions of postfix?
